Transaction 20e7f80a087dfb67d176bfc85e9982d7ea36e4525af66180471ac5fa6071a601

1 Input
2 Outputs
  • 20e7f80a087dfb67d176bfc85e9982d7ea36e4525af66180471ac5fa6071a601:0
  • value  6083641
    address  3DFAtaEyhg4obRkLFPtju1b8a4MLKjNqDq
  • 20e7f80a087dfb67d176bfc85e9982d7ea36e4525af66180471ac5fa6071a601:1
  • value  285708
    address  bc1qjsmrsqnkv4cu8wl4ql2dh5mp85dhvq9rupgm0r